Web1 de fev. de 2024 · According to rent control laws in most states, renters must be granted at least 30 days’ written notice before a new rent increase is enforced, although that can … WebThe rent cap and eviction ban. The Scottish government has introduced a temporary rent cap and ban on evictions. This means a landlord cannot increase the rent by more than 3% or carry out evictions until at least 30 September 2024 except in limited circumstances. Read more about the rent cap and eviction ban on the Shelter Scotland website.
